West End, Floral Park, NY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in West End?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| West End 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,725 | $2,500 | $3,000 |
| West End 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,600 | $2,800 | $5,000 |
| West End 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,976 | $3,600 | $5,988 |
| West End 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,500 | $4,500 | $4,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about West End
What type of rentals are currently available in West End?
There are currently 130 Apartments for Rent in West End, NY with pricing that ranges from $800 to $6,500. There are also 31 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in West End ranging from $1,900 to $5,988.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in West End?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in West End ranges from $1,900 to $5,988 with an average monthly rent of $3,577.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in West End?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in West End range from $2,950 to $4,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,800 to $5,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,600 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$3,800.
